Backpacking Basics: Exploring America's Wilderness on Foot exploring
Lace up your boots and hit the trail! Backpacking is a enchanting way to experience the raw beauty of America's wilderness. Whether you're a seasoned hiker or just starting out, mastering the basics will set you up for a safe and unforgettable adventure. First things first, choose your gear wisely. A comfortable backpack, durable boots, and weather-appropriate clothing are crucial. Pack plenty of food and water, as resupply options can be limited in remote areas.
- Before you head out, acclimate yourself with the trail map and weather forecast.
- Practice your navigation skills using a compass and topographic maps.
- Leave no trace behind; pack out everything you pack in.
Remember to respect the environment and its inhabitants. Embrace in the solitude, the stunning views, and the sense of accomplishment that comes with reaching your destination. Happy exploring!

Pack It In & Head Out: Your First Backpacking Trip Across the U.S.{
Packing for your maiden cross-country backpacking trip can be a daunting task. Take a deep breath, though! With a little foresight, you can easily gather the essentials and embark on your journey.
Start by picking a reliable backpack that fits your expectations. Next, pack it with compact clothing items like layers for warmth, rain gear, and comfortable hiking shoes.
Remember to bring a first-aid kit, water purification system, headlamp, and a GPS. Don't forget food that is high-energy.
